From dd3cefeb123bf7b72be455311a44c74d6a3d5afe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=A9=AC=E5=AE=8F=E8=BE=BE?= <2657224306@qq.com> Date: Thu, 7 Sep 2023 22:10:11 +0800 Subject: [PATCH] =?UTF-8?q?=E4=B9=9D=E6=9C=88=E4=B8=83=E6=97=A5=E4=BD=9C?= =?UTF-8?q?=E4=B8=9A?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- ...07\346\227\245\344\275\234\344\270\232.md" | 31 +++++++++++++++++++ 1 file changed, 31 insertions(+) create mode 100644 "48 \351\251\254\345\256\217\350\276\276/9\346\234\2107\346\227\245\344\275\234\344\270\232.md" diff --git "a/48 \351\251\254\345\256\217\350\276\276/9\346\234\2107\346\227\245\344\275\234\344\270\232.md" "b/48 \351\251\254\345\256\217\350\276\276/9\346\234\2107\346\227\245\344\275\234\344\270\232.md" new file mode 100644 index 0000000..e2a5025 --- /dev/null +++ "b/48 \351\251\254\345\256\217\350\276\276/9\346\234\2107\346\227\245\344\275\234\344\270\232.md" @@ -0,0 +1,31 @@ +笔记 +== + +表与表之间的关系 +----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- + +1、一对一的关系 + +一、两张表的主键,建立外键约束。 + +-- 建立一对一关系:一夫一妻 + + + + +2、一对多的关系 + +一、将一所在的表放在多那个表中当外键 + +3、多对多的关系 + +一、需要创建第三个表,将前面两个表中的主键放到第三个表中当外键 +数据库范式 + +----------------------------------------------------------------------------------------------------------------------------------------------------------------------------- + +1、第一范式:要求字段的内容不可再分,为保证数据的原子性。 + +2、第二范式:要求满足第一范式的基础上,要求非主键字段要完全依赖主键,而不能只依赖部分, + +3、第三范式:要求满足第二范式前提上,要非主键属性要直接依赖主键。 -- Gitee